Medical Reception Traineeship
Your Host Employer:
Calvary North Adelaide Hospital offers an extensive range of surgical services; cancer services including Kimberley House Day Chemotherapy Unit; Calvary Babies; and Mary Potter Hospice palliative and end of life care. Their fully refurbished procedure suite and Day of Surgery Unit includes three procedure rooms and seven theatres specialising in general / colorectal surgery, urology and gynaecology in addition to a broad range of surgical procedures.
Maxima, in partnership with Calvary North Adelaide, are looking for a motivated and customer-focused individual to join their patient services team as a Receptionist Trainee.
This 18-month traineeship will see you becoming an expert in juggling a busy reception desk through practical experience and studying online towards achieving a nationally recognised Certificate III in Business with a Medical Specialisation.
What will you do?
- Meet and greet patients and visitors
- Answer incoming telephone calls and follow-up where required
- Create and maintain patient records
- Process payments and Medicare rebates
- Additional duties as required including tidy waiting room etc.
What do you need?
- A positive and proactive attitude
- Demonstrated high attention to detail
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Effective organisational and time management skills
- Working with Children Check (or willing to obtain)
- COVID-19 Vaccinations (including booster) and up to date with all other required vaccines.
